WebA physical property is a characteristic of a substance that can be observed or measured without changing the identity of the substance. Physical properties include color, density, hardness, and melting and boiling points. WebMay 10, 2024 · This is an extensive list of physical properties of matter. These are characteristics that you can observe and measure without altering a sample. Unlike chemical properties, you do not need to change the nature of a substance to measure any physical property it might have.
